About Geneva, IL

Geneva is a city in Illinois, located in Kane County. The city spans 1 ZIP code and is home to approximately 29,838 residents. It is a middle-aged city, with a median age of 39.7 years.

Economically, Geneva is a upper-middle-income community. The median household income of $148,283 is significantly above the national average. Approximately 2.7% of residents live below the poverty line. The unemployment rate is 3.5%, below the national average.

The real estate market in Geneva is a premium housing market. Median home values stand at $427,300, which is significantly above the national average. Renters typically pay around $1,816 per month. Homeownership is high at 85.2%, typical of suburban and family-oriented communities.

The population of Geneva is highly educated. 73.9%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her — significantly above the national average. The community is primarily White (84.98%).
